PRODUCT DESCRIPTION Product Functions The A601X series is our most popular and durable stopwatch for your basic timing needs. • It works on the WOS 2.5 Operating system • It takes Cumulative Splits only (No Lap) • Split/Release Action • 1, 2 Fast Finish • Event/Time Out • 24 Hour Timing Range • The Timing interval is 1/100 Second to 40 minutes • 12/24 Time of Day • Month and Date Product Features • Cased in ACCUSPLIT’s Exclusive “X” Case, with its distinctive, ergonomic design. The “X” Case is immediately recognizable to anyone involved in elite sports • Million cycle No Fail Buttons (No beep) • 5 Year, DUAL No Proof of & Proof of Purchase Limited Warranty • Magnum XL Display for easy viewing • Water resistant up to 100 feet • Shock resistant • Now with 5 year lithium (CR2032) battery (3v & 3v.1 versions) • Expected battery life of 5 years • Available in 5 solid (Black, blue, red, yellow, green) and 5 translucent (Smoke, aqua, cherry, lemon, lime) Case colors. • RESOLUTION & ACCURACY LIMIT: The internal Quartz and IC controller LOOKS AT SWITCH CLOSURE every 1/256th of a second, so that nearest 1/100 is captured. • ACTUAL ACCURACY: Tested and calibrated to be within 0.04 sec/hour for 12 months. Only shocks and aging of the quartz crystal affect this actual accuracy rating. AMAZON.COM The Accusplit Survivor A601X Stopwatch is the best value PE stopwatch on the market. With the exclusive Accusplit 'X' case design and the million-cycle switch buttons, this is the most durable and popular stopwatch for basic timing needs. The million-cycle no-fail switches are an Accusplit exclusive and are ergonomically designed for maximum performance and ease of use. They snap instead of beep and have been tested for over a million cycles without failure. The A601X operates on the Watch Company Operating System (WOS 2.5) used by most watch manufacturers, which employs a two-button system. The right button is used for start and stop, the left for split and release. The A601X stopwatch features cumulative-split timing. The cumulative time is the capture of elapsed time to current event and consists of all splits beginning to end. The split time is the interval of time measured from the start of the timing to the next pause of time. The A601X also features the one-button start-split-split system where the first split is first place, the second split is second place, and it shows a one-two fast finish. This stopwatch is available in five solid and translucent ring colors, has a 5-year battery life, and has a magnum extra-large digital display for exceptionally easy reading. The A601X is water resistant (up to 30-meters), shock resistant, and includes time and date functions, making it a great low-cost stopwatch for basic timing needs.

Read the features carefully before buying - no lap memory.
As even my 10 year old Casio watch has a lap memory, I thought a dedicated stopwatch would have that as well. My fault for not reading the description carefully. This will capture splits, but only show them in the moment (no memory), and when you hit split again, you only see the current cumulative timing. May as well use your phone. For just a stopwatch w/ easy to use buttons and a decent-sized display, it works, though.

Accusplit Stopwatch ceases to record hundreds of a second after 40 minutes
I bought this stopwatch for timing my son, who recently started running. The stopwatch is great for use on a track . . . for timing speed workouts, etc. The buttons are big and easy to use, and likewise the display is nice and big to see. But there is one big PROBLEM with the stopwatch, that Accusplit needs to FIX. My son also does distance training runs. And even though the stopwatch clearly advertises on the face of it 1/100 seconds, what happens is that this function ceases to work at 40 minutes. It's not that I need the hundreds of a second on long runs, but the actual display becomes quite annoying. One moment the stopwatch is counting quickly, counting minutes, seconds, and hundreds. Then suddenly, it is only timing minutes and seconds. The reason this is annoying? The first several times this happened, the 'perception' is that the stopwatch had STOPPED, and I thought I had bumped it or accidentally hit a button. It took watching it during several distance runs, when I just happened to be looking at it just past 39 minutes to realize what was happening. I could understand if the hundreds disappeared at 1 hour, due to the lack of digits. But the amount of digits at 39:59:99 are exactly the same as what it SHOULD be at 40:00.00. But instead it is now only showing 40:00. Accusplit should immediately fix this problem. I actually called Accusplit about this, thinking I had a malfunctioning stopwatch. But after several calls, they got back to me and simply said "This is the way it was designed." My question is: "WHY?". If they would simply fix this, I would have rated the stopwatch with 5 Stars. But this weird anomaly causes me to only give it 3 Stars. I simply want others purchasing this stopwatch to be aware of this oddity on it. If you ONLY plan to use it for short distances on a track, it would be a great watch. But for distance running workouts, not so great.
